Brooches: From Occasion Wear to Everyday Expression

For a long time, brooches were seen in a very specific way.

Formal. Occasional. Reserved.

They were pinned onto blazers for events, ceremonies, or traditional gatherings - worn with intention, but rarely as part of everyday style.

And somewhere along the way, they became predictable.

But that perception is changing.

Today, brooches are no longer confined to formal wear or special occasions. They’re becoming one of the most versatile and expressive accessories something that reflects personality more than protocol.

Design Has Opened Everything Up

One of the biggest reasons behind this shift is design.

Earlier, brooches followed a more traditional aesthetic - ornate, structured, and often tied to formal wear.

Now, the landscape is completely different.

You’ll find:

  • Minimal and clean designs

  • Playful and quirky motifs

  • Abstract and statement pieces

  • Modern interpretations of classic forms

With so many options, brooches are no longer about fitting into an outfit - they’re about adding something personal to it.

From Occasions to Everyday

Brooches are quietly becoming part of everyday styling.

They’re being worn:

  • On shirts and t-shirts

  • On dresses and sarees

  • On jackets, coats, and even denim

  • On scarves, bags, and accessories

A single piece can shift the entire feel of an outfit.

A plain shirt becomes styled.
A simple dress feels intentional.
A layered outfit gets structure.

It’s a small detail with a strong impact.

A Shift in Who’s Wearing Them

Traditionally, brooches had a more visible presence in men’s formalwear - especially in blazers and bandhgalas.

But today, women are embracing brooches in a much bigger way.

They’re experimenting with placement, styling them across different outfits, and using them as statement elements rather than occasional accessories.

At the same time, brooches are also becoming more gender-neutral.

They’re no longer designed or marketed for a specific group.
They’re simply made to be worn by anyone who resonates with them.
